Frequently Asked Questions

What is Lee Middle/High School's grade rating?

Lee Middle/High School has earned a grade of C+, ranked #216 in Massachusetts, placing it in the top 62% of Massachusetts Combined schools. This rating is based on 2025 MCAS test scores, attendance rates, and other performance metrics from the Massachusetts Department of Elementary and Secondary Education.

How many students attend Lee Middle/High School?

Approximately 328 students are enrolled at Lee Middle/High School.

How does Lee Middle/High School perform on MCAS tests?

Based on the most recent MCAS results, Lee Middle/High School's proficiency rates are: CIV (39% proficient), English Language Arts (46% proficient), Mathematics (33% proficient). MCAS (Massachusetts Comprehensive Assessment System) tests measure student achievement in English Language Arts, Mathematics, and Science.

What is the graduation rate at Lee Middle/High School?

Lee Middle/High School has a excellent 98.1% graduation rate. The state average graduation rate in Massachusetts is approximately 89%.

What is the attendance rate at Lee Middle/High School?

Lee Middle/High School has an attendance rate of 92.6%. Strong attendance is correlated with better academic outcomes.

What school district is Lee Middle/High School part of?

Lee Middle/High School is part of Lee School District. For enrollment information, contact the district office or visit the school's website. Enrollment typically requires proof of residency within the district boundaries.

How are Massachusetts school ratings calculated?

School ratings are calculated using multiple data points from the Massachusetts Department of Elementary and Secondary Education (DESE), including MCAS test scores (proficiency and growth), attendance rates, graduation rates (for high schools), and student-teacher ratios. Schools are ranked by percentile against similar schools statewide.
